How they voted

The Senate voted 25 to 10 Tuesday to allow 24-hour gambling, 7 days a week at Twin River and to require the slot parlor to run a full 200-day greyhound racing season

Voting YES

Bates, R-Barrington

Ciccone, D-Providence

Connors, D-Cumberland

Crowley, D-Central Falls

DaPonte, D-East Providence

DeVall, D-East Providence

Doyle, D-Pawtucket

Felag, D-Warren

Fogarty, D-Glocester

Gallo, D-Cranston

Goodwin, D-Providence

Jabour, D-Providence

Lanzi, D-Cranston

Levesque, D-Portsmouth

Lynch, D-Warwick

Maselli, D-Johnston

McBurney, D-Pawtucket

McCaffrey, D-Warwick

Miller, D-Cranston

Perry, D-Providence

Picard, D-Woonsocket

Pichardo, D-Providence

Ruggerio, D-Providence

Sosnowski, D-South Kingstown

Tassoni, D-Smithfield

Voting NO

Algiere, R-Westerly

Blais, R-Coventry

Cote, D-Woonsocket

DiPalma, D-Middletown

Lenihan, D-East Greenwich

Maher, R-Exeter

Metts, D-Providence

O’Neill, I-Lincoln

Pinga, D-West Warwick

Sheehan, D-North Kingstown

Not voting

Paiva Weed, D-Newport

Raptakis, D-Coventry

Walaska, D-Warwick

SOURCE: Senate roll call
